Recommended 22" tires for 2010 Camaro
245/35-22 = 28.8" tall, 8.0-8.5 wheel
255/35-22 = 29.0" tall, 8.0-8.5 wheel
265/30-22 = 28.3" tall, 8.5-9.0 wheel
275/30-22 = 28.5" tall, 9.0-9.5 wheel
285/30-22 = 28.8" tall, 9.5-10.0 wheel
295/30-22 = 28.9" tall, 9.5-10.5 wheel
305/30-22 = 29.2" tall, 10.0-11.0 wheel
315/25-22 = 28.2" tall, 10.5-11.0 wheel

Yes, it will physically fit on the wheel. It will bulge quite a bit though, and probably handle a little sketchy in corners. I wouldn't sell a 315 tire for a 10" wheel, personally. 10.5 wheel is already on the narrow side for the 315. Even a 305 wide tire bulges quite a bit on a 10" wheel.

Also, your wheel offset will need to be completely different if you plan on using a 315 tire on the 10" wheel. The tires will stick out past the quarter-panels unless you increase the offset to account for the extra width back there. This is very critical if you decide to lower the car.

When you look at larger wheels and tires you need to be careful and consider all factors impacting fit. A tool like what Rims-N-Tires has on their web site is quite helpful, see: http://www.rimsntires.com/specs.jsp --> once there put in both the stock wheel/tire sizes and then what wheel/tire combination you want to use.

The tool will show you all around clearance comparison to the stock setup.

It will also show you what size wheels are recommended for a given tire size which would answer your original question.

It shows that for a 315 tire you should use a wheel size ranging from 10 to 12 inches in width - so the 10 inch wheels would be on the small side for this tire.

On the front the perfect offset would be ~ +35, on the back +40 --> based on what I put on my car (I have 20 X 10 with +40 offset front and back - the front is real close to strut tower on mine).

I have 275 tires on front 305 tires on back - if you are going with 305 all around you may need something like +30 on the front.
